CVE-2024-35515: sqlitedict insecure deserialization vulnerability

September 18, 2024

Insecure deserialization in sqlitedict up to v2.1.0 allows attackers to execute arbitrary code.

Affected versions

All versions up to 2.1.0

Solution

Unfortunately, there is no solution available yet.

Impact 9.8 CRITICAL

C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H

Learn more about CVSS

Weakness

  • CWE-502: Deserialization of Untrusted Data
  • CWE-94: Improper Control of Generation of Code ('Code Injection')
